Circuits and Trees

Circuits and Trees are two basic structures of planar networks. A circuit is a closed path, with no less than three links, that begins and ends at the same node. A tree is a set of connected lines that cannot form a complete circuit. [1]

At the individual trip level, the treeness is estimated as:

ϕtree=ltblsb

where:

ltb = Length (km) of street segments belonging to a branch network within the buffer,

lsb = Total length (km) of the street network within the buffer.
